CVE-2025-14177 Information Leak of Memory in getimagesize

In PHP versions:8.1. before 8.1.34, 8.2. before 8.2.30, 8.3. before 8.3.29, 8.4. before 8.4.16, 8.5. before 8.5.1, the getimagesize function may leak uninitialized heap memory into the APPn segments e.g., APP1 when reading images in multi-chunk mode such as via php://filter.
